I want to brief our membership on the NAIFA National Business Meeting and some of the remarkable speakers that we heard.  Some were great industry speakers who educated and motivated. Others were speakers who were not specific to our industry, but still inspired and challenged us to be leaders and serve others.

 

Jim McCormick, an accomplished business executive, is one of only 400 skydiving exhibitionists and holder of 5 world records. Jim showed us how to use intelligent risk-taking as a strategy to achieve performance improvement. Jim is the author of Business Lessons from the Edge and The Power of Risk.

 

Firefighter Richard Picciotto was our speaker on Sunday, September 11th. Following the terrorist attack, Picciotto rushed inside the World Trade Center to rescue those inside, but soon found himself trapped in the smoldering rubble of the North Tower after its collapse. Buried for more than four hours, he emerged almost unscathed and was the highest-ranking firefighter to survive the collapse. Chief Picciotto detailed his story demonstrating life saving leadership and courageous decision-making.

 

On Tuesday September 13th, General Colin Powell spoke for several hours on leadership. General Powell is an experienced leader having led troops as a military leader and Chairman of Joint Chiefs of Staff and having served as Secretary of State. But, General Powell believes a leader is more than just his or her title. He drew on examples garnered from experience as both a leader on the world stage and as eyewitness to leadership in action.  General Powell illustrated precisely what it takes to be a leader, providing strategies for taking charge during times of great change and great crisis.

 

One of my favorite speakers was our first on Saturday, September 10th, Keni Thomas, a Task Force Ranger and Bronze Star for Valor recipient.  Keni was an engaging motivational leadership speaker whose story captivated the audience from beginning to end. The highly successful movie, Blackhawk Down, is based on his company’s mission in Mogadishu, Somalia. Keni gave us moment-by-moment details of the fight to save the lives of his fellow Rangers and Delta soldiers. He detailed instances where soldiers displayed heroism, teamwork and leadership. In his book, Get It On, he reminds us that we as individuals do indeed matter, that we are anything but ordinary, and that we are fully capable of carrying out life changing assignments at any level and in any situation. We can make a difference in this world.
